Two years post-gastric sleeve surgery, you might find yourself facing weight regain. It's not uncommon, and it doesn't mean the procedure was a failure. Weight fluctuations are a possibility after any significant weight loss surgery, and understanding the reasons behind weight regain is crucial to getting back on track. This comprehensive guide will explore the reasons for weight regain after a gastric sleeve, potential solutions, and how to achieve a successful "reset."

Why Has My Weight Increased After Gastric Sleeve Surgery?

Many factors contribute to weight regain after a gastric sleeve. Let's delve into the most common reasons:

1. Lifestyle Changes:

  • Dietary Habits: Slipping back into old eating habits is a major culprit. Consuming high-calorie, processed foods, neglecting proper portion control, and failing to prioritize nutrient-dense meals all contribute to weight gain.
  • Lack of Exercise: Regular physical activity is essential for maintaining a healthy weight and overall well-being. Inactivity, after initial weight loss, can easily lead to regaining lost pounds.
  • Stress and Emotional Eating: Stress and emotional triggers can lead to overeating and unhealthy food choices.

2. Medical Issues:

  • Hormonal Imbalances: Certain hormonal changes can affect metabolism and appetite, potentially impacting weight management.
  • Medications: Some medications can cause weight gain as a side effect. It's vital to discuss any medications with your doctor to rule this out.
  • Underlying Medical Conditions: Conditions such as hypothyroidism can also contribute to weight gain. A comprehensive health checkup is essential.

3. Gastric Sleeve Complications:

  • Stretching of the Stomach Pouch: While rare, the stomach pouch can stretch over time if eating habits aren't carefully managed. This reduces the restrictive effect of the surgery.
  • Gastroparesis: This condition, involving delayed stomach emptying, can impact nutrient absorption and contribute to weight gain.

What Can I Do to Reset My Gastric Sleeve Journey?

A "reset" involves carefully reassessing your lifestyle and addressing the underlying causes of your weight regain. Here’s a step-by-step approach:

1. Consult Your Surgeon and Dietitian:

This is the most critical first step. Your surgical team can assess your situation, identify potential issues (like stomach pouch stretching or medical conditions), and recommend a personalized plan.

2. Re-evaluate Your Diet:

  • Portion Control: Strictly adhere to recommended portion sizes.
  • Nutrient-Dense Foods: Focus on lean protein, fruits, vegetables, and whole grains.
  • Hydration: Drink plenty of water throughout the day.
  • Eliminate Processed Foods and Sugary Drinks: These are calorie-dense and offer minimal nutritional value.

3. Incorporate Regular Exercise:

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ity or 75 minutes of vigorous-intensity aerobic activity per week, along with strength training exercises twice a week. Consult your doctor before starting a new exercise routine.

4. Address Emotional Eating:

Consider strategies to manage stress, such as meditation, yoga, or therapy. Learn to recognize emotional triggers and develop healthier coping mechanisms.

5. Medication Review:

Talk to your doctor about any medications you're taking that might contribute to weight gain. They can explore alternative options if necessary.

6. Regular Follow-Up Appointments:

Maintain regular appointments with your surgical team to monitor your progress, address any concerns, and make necessary adjustments to your plan.

Gastric Sleeve Reset: Is it Too Late?

It's never too late to reset your weight loss journey after gastric sleeve surgery. With a proactive approach, focusing on dietary changes, increased physical activity, stress management, and close monitoring by your medical team, you can achieve sustainable weight loss and regain control of your health. Remember consistency and patience are key.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Can you regain all the weight after gastric sleeve surgery?

While it's possible to regain some weight, regaining all the weight is less likely if you adhere to a healthy lifestyle. However, significant weight regain does highlight the need to revisit dietary habits and lifestyle choices.

How long does it take to see results after a gastric sleeve reset?

The time it takes to see noticeable results varies depending on individual factors, but with consistent effort, you should begin to see positive changes within a few weeks to months.

What are the long-term effects of a gastric sleeve?

Long-term success depends on lifestyle changes. Those who maintain healthy eating habits and regular exercise generally enjoy lasting weight loss and improved overall health. However, regular follow-up care is vital.

Is gastric sleeve revision surgery an option?

In some cases, revision surgery might be considered if conservative methods fail to yield satisfactory results. However, it's usually a last resort, and discussing this option with your surgeon is crucial.
